Abstract

Abstract One of the most important, useful and promising grain crops is winter rye. The advantage of winter rust is: resistance to winter and cold, adaptation to a stress factor, high content of minerals and vitamins in grain. The rye grain contains 13% protein, as well as a large amount of minerals such as: manganese, boron, aluminum, iodine, bromine, fluorine, cobalt, molybdenum, strontium, cesium, copper and also vitamins A1, B1, B2, E3, threonine and tyrosine other substances. Therefore, rye bread is considered the main dietary bread. In recent years, the need for rye bread has been increasing. This research intends to analyze formation of the leaf surface and grain yield of winter rye while using different type of mineral fertilizers. The results showed that at earlier sowing dates, the use of foliar feeding and the Baikal biostimulant had a positive effect on the formation of winter rye fruit elements. Accordingly, the highest indicator in terms of grain weight per 1 ear of 1.37 grams was noted at early sowing dates using foliar feeding, an increase from the control was 0.47 grams.
